The Kilroy is an awesome universal kayak.. Coming out of a pro angler I think it's just as stable standing up.. Moves just as fast with a brisk paddle. I've been clocked around 5 mph without breaking a sweat. Has TONS of storage . All around the seat and under the seat.
It's the perfect freshwater kayak. I've taken out to the bridge and had no issues. I wouldn't take on a bad day tho.
I'm very pleased with it. The dash board is handy as well. Have 6 tackle boxes in the yak without anything in the way.. Fits a blak pak perfect.
